Congratulations to MBS sophomore Zachary Braun ’25, who recently earned the Bronze Presidential Volunteer Service Award for his volunteer work with SNAP (Special Needs Athletic Programs) of Morristown.
In addition to being engaged in weekly mentoring at SNAP’s sports clinics, Zach co-authored a new mentor training manual for SNAP entitled SCORE (Show up, Commit, Open mind, Relate, Empathy/evaluate). He also spent countless hours fine-tuning a presentation that will debut at SNAP’s new mentor training on September 21.
“SNAP is an organization that prides itself in providing free sports clinics for kids with special needs. This can only be successful with the assistance of mentors like Zach who go above and beyond to provide a meaningful experience for these well-deserving kids,” said SNAP Director Kimberle Strasser. “His positive attitude and leadership skills are assets we are proud of. I look forward to Zach mentoring for SNAP in the future and inspiring others.”
At Morristown Beard School, Zach is a member of the winter track and lacrosse teams. He is also active with the Future Physicians of America Club and the Interdisciplinary Concentrations Program (ICP).
